Matthew 12:27-37 New American Standard Bible (NASB)

27. If I by Beelzebul cast out demons, by whom do your sons cast them out? For this reason they will be your judges.

28. But if I cast out demons by the Spirit of God, then the kingdom of God has come upon you.

29. Or how can anyone enter the strong man's house and carry off his property, unless he first binds the strong man? And then he will plunder his house.

30. He who is not with Me is against Me; and he who does not gather with Me scatters.

31. "Therefore I say to you, any sin and blasphemy shall be forgiven people, but blasphemy against the Spirit shall not be forgiven.

32. Whoever speaks a word against the Son of Man, it shall be forgiven him; but whoever speaks against the Holy Spirit, it shall not be forgiven him, either in this age or in the age to come.

33. "Either make the tree good and its fruit good, or make the tree bad and its fruit bad; for the tree is known by its fruit.

34. You brood of vipers, how can you, being evil, speak what is good? For the mouth speaks out of that which fills the heart.

35. The good man brings out of his good treasure what is good; and the evil man brings out of his evil treasure what is evil.

36. But I tell you that every careless word that people speak, they shall give an accounting for it in the day of judgment.

37. For by your words you will be justified, and by your words you will be condemned."
